Hanwha Vision debuts powerful AI remote-head camera

HANWHA VISION has launched the Artificial Intelligence (AI) remote-head camera, featuring a single-body design with support for up to four channels, rendering this model ideal for a multitude of applications and sites. The advanced multi-sensor solution delivers intelligence and comprehensive monitoring in a compact and discreet form.

An intelligent design has been developed for a range of uses where a discreet presence is needed, or for the monitoring of more confined spaces (for example ATMs, entrances and retail counters). The four-channel remote-head camera, designated model number PNM-C20000QB, can be installed together with a range of Hanwha Vision accessories that include 2 MP and 5 MP lens modules.

AI object and attribute detection, alongside colour detection (upper/lower clothing and vehicle), are supported on all four channels. The solution also provides four audio inputs and one output channel for synchronised audio-video monitoring.

An HDMI port enables seamless local monitoring of the video signal from all four channels without the need for additional computing power. The integration of shock detection via built-in gyro sensors further strengthens operators’ situational awareness by alerting them to impacts or tampering.

Powerful suite of analytics

AI-powered analytics enable real-time detection of people, faces, vehicles and licence plates. AI algorithms can discern these objects from surrounding irrelevant motion, meaning that motion detection alarms are only triggered when specific objects are moving in a scene.

Event-based alerts can also be triggered for virtual-line crossing, area intrusion, loitering and directional movement in a boost to safety and security.

The remote-head camera features BestShot, a powerful function that captures and transmits the most relevant images of classified objects. These images, cropped directly around the detected objects by AI, accelerate forensic searches. Colour detection of clothing and vehicles also bolsters forensic search, in turn improving investigation efficiency.

Further, business intelligence insights, such as people and vehicle counting, add value beyond security to streamline operations, inform marketing and sales and aid with store or site layout design.

Next-level cyber security

The solution includes Hanwha Vision’s next-level cyber security with features such as user authentication and secure communication, access control and audit. An embedded secure element meets FIPS 140-3 Level 3 and CC EAL6+ standards, ensuring “top-tier data protection” and system integrity.

Additionally, a detachable installation plate simplifies mounting and adjustments, thereby making installation, repositioning or replacement procedures quick and hassle-free.
